I feel like a scene in Richard Scarry's "Busy, Busy World". I've been sewing again and even have some knitting to show you.
Two weeks ago I bought the yarn for the Baby's Denim Drawstring Pants (from Last Minute Knitted Gifts). This is how they looked this past Monday:
And this is how they looked on Wednesday:
I just need to knit the drawstring and then wash them to shrink up the length. I'm wondering, though, how much my gauge is off b/c the pattern called for 4 balls of yarn and I only used 3. I'm sure they'll fit him at some point.
Now, I would have been finished these pants much faster, but I felt the need to use up some yarn that had been marinating in the stash. This was my bus knitting (oh heck, the pants were bus knitting too, but they took turns):
It's a Le Slouch by Wendy of Knit and Tonic. This one is significantly more slouchy than the one I knit previously. I haven't even blocked it yet!
Yarn: Araucania Nature Wolle Chunky
Needles: 5.0 and 5.5mm
Yesterday, I spent the afternoon in front of the sewing machine. I've got a pile of flannel and only 15 weeks to go! AAAAAH!
So, I made six burp cloths - all double layers of flannel:
The burp cloths all measure around 14x19 inches - yes inches. I know. I can't help it. I work in both!
And, I made another big blanket - the burp cloth is there for scale:
Today, I'm going to make another big blanket and then get back to knitting on a cotton blanket for the Mogrunt.
*mumbles through a mouth full of twigs* "Did someone say something about nesting?"
